Synopsis
|
|
|
The economic crisis has transformed the Asia/Pacific enterprise applications market landscape. From end customer emerging needs, new application module in demand and financial crisis expediting changes in the application delivery model. Organizations are now looking at newer engagement models but remain selective on IT projects using project cost and return on investment as their key decision-making factors; while vendors emphasized multiple pricing and delivery models, pre-packaged vertical specific templates, and pre-integrated application stacks to reduce the initial investment and implementation time. The channel ecosystem is also transforming to meet the emerging needs of the market.
According to IDC’s Asia/Pacific Semiannual Enterprise Applications Tracker, the enterprise applications software market in the Asia/Pacific excluding Japan (APEJ) region returned to positive growth in 2H 2009. The rebound is expected to continue, and IDC forecasts the enterprise applications market to grow by 15.4% in 2010 even as customers focus on cost reduction, customer retention and business expansion.
In this LIVE web conference, Praveen Sengar, Research Manager, Enterprise Application Software, Domain Research Group, IDC Asia/Pacific,will provide an overview of the Asia/Pacific applications market and give his assessment of the fast-evolving ICT vendor-partner ecosystem.
